  1. Ok so here it is. My problems started when I was driving home one day stopped at a store came back out wouldn't start ??? finally after a couple tries it started; drove home got mail coming up to the driveway she stalled ??? Would not start. So I pushed it into the garage with fourwheeler still wouldn't start. Left it alone for a while (hour) came back out started up ran fine ??? Went to the store again it died on the road so I called buddy to come rescue me on the road with my trailer ; he shows up about half hour later and it started right up ??? So I drove onto the trailer and brought it home. I took it to my buddies garage to scan it NO CODES So we assume it's the distributer ??? I brought it back home and changed all the parts in the distributer (have a broke spare motor)No change starts up runs a little bit ; til warm then shuts down and won't start. til it cools all the way down (never typed this much in my life ) SOOOOO I took it to the Nissan dealer they looked at it tried to scan NO CODES again ???? They said it looked like my MAF was messed up so I replaced that; no change ??? I didn't think that would work but I figured what the hell . So me and a buddy decided to change the crank position censor because it doesn't seem to be getting spark when it won't start. Now it won't start at all. I've givin up and don't know what to do next. Any suggestion would be appreciated. I ready to blow it up and start over with something old with no effing computer!!!!!

  5. That is the parts I'm saying to beef up!!! They are easy to change . there is a metal washer on the rack side that is bent over the nut.. I know there is a tool just for this job but I just always use a pipe wrench seems to work fine. Bad part is that you have to remove skid plate just to see the rack side. an example of my modified on and some bent stock ones
